For the Absolute Beginner:
- "Astrology for Beginners" by Dr. B.V. Raman: This classic by a renowned Vedic astrologer offers a foundational understanding of Jyotish's core concepts like planets, signs, and houses.
- "Vedic Astrology for Beginners: An Introduction to the Origins and Core Concepts of Jyotish" by Pamela McDonough: This user-friendly guide presents Jyotish in a clear and concise way, perfect for those new to astrological terms.
As You Progress:
- "Light on Life" by Hart de Fouw: This insightful book delves into the philosophical and spiritual underpinnings of Jyotish, helping you connect astrology with your inner world.
- "The Art and Science of Vedic Astrology" by W. Ryan Kurczak: This series offers a comprehensive exploration of Jyotish principles, taking you beyond the basics into intermediate and advanced topics.
Understanding the Nakshatras:
- "Nakshatra: The Authentic Heart of Vedic Astrology" by Vic DiCara: This book sheds light on the significance of Nakshatras, the lunar mansions, which hold immense depth in Jyotish.
